About Anderson Elem.
Anderson Elem., located in Anderson, Missouri, is a rural elementary school serving students from pre-kindergarten through fifth grade. With an enrollment of 532 students and a student-teacher ratio of 13.3:1, the school provides personalized attention to its young learners. The campus houses 40 full-time equivalent teachers who work diligently to support each child's educational journey.
Anderson Elem.'s academic performance is solid but shows room for improvement, with state rankings placing it at #1092 out of 2234 schools in Missouri. In reading and ELA, 54% of students are proficient or above, while in math, the figure stands at 50%. These scores highlight areas where the school is focusing on further student development.

Performance Trends
Math proficiency has declined from 56% (2019) to 45% (2022). Reading/ELA proficiency has declined from 62% (2019) to 48% (2022).

Community Profile
The community surrounding Anderson Elem. has a median household income of $58,589. It is a community where 15%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her. The median home value in the area is $147,700, with a median rent of $777/month. The area has a poverty rate of 13.3%. The average commute for residents is 26 minutes.
